(CTNM) reported a Q1 2026 net loss of -$0.39 per share, outperforming analyst estimates of -$0.5421 by 28.06%. The company, which remains pre-revenue, generated no top-line revenue during the quarter. Following the announcement, shares declined by approximately 3.55%, reflecting market focus on ongoing development costs and the absence of near-term catalysts.

Contineum Therapeutics’ first-quarter results were primarily driven by its investment in clinical-stage pipeline programs targeting oncology and neurodegenerative diseases. With no approved products or commercial revenue, the company’s operating expenses largely reflect research and development costs, as well as general and administrative overhead. The narrower-than-expected loss suggests disciplined spending on R&D and a potential delay in certain trial-related expenditures, though management has not disclosed specific line items. The company continues to advance its lead candidates, with key data readouts expected in upcoming quarters. As a clinical-stage biotech, Contineum’s financial performance is closely tied to scientific progress rather than sales volume. The negative EPS is typical for firms in this phase, and the 28% surprise beat may signal effective cost management or a shift in spending priorities. Investors will watch for updates on the company’s pipeline progression and any partnership announcements that could extend the cash runway. Contineum Therapeutics Inc. In the earnings release, management reiterated its focus on advancing its pipeline candidates and noted that the company’s cash position remains sufficient to fund operations into the next fiscal year. While no formal financial guidance was provided, the company expects to provide clinical data updates for its lead programs in the coming months. Risks include clinical trial delays, regulatory uncertainties, and the need for additional capital to fund later-stage studies. Contineum may also seek strategic collaborations to offset development costs and validate its technology. The negative earnings per share reflect the ongoing investment phase, and the company anticipates that operating expenses will remain elevated as trials progress. Investors should monitor enrollment timelines and any early signals of efficacy or safety from ongoing studies. The absence of revenue underscores the binary nature of Contineum’s stock performance, which may hinge on future clinical results rather than near-term financial metrics. Contineum Therapeutics Inc. Following the Q1 2026 print, CTNM shares closed down roughly 3.55%, a modest move that likely reflects the market’s tempered reaction to the in-line operational results. Analyst commentary has been cautious, with several firms maintaining a neutral stance pending key clinical milestones. The earnings beat, while positive, may not materially alter the company’s valuation given the long-duration nature of its pipeline. Looking ahead, the most important catalyst for Contineum will be the disclosure of phase 2 data for its lead asset, expected later this year. Investors should also watch for updates on cash burn and any potential licensing deals. The stock’s current price may already discount a high degree of uncertainty. Without near-term revenue catalysts, share price movements may continue to be driven by sentiment around the biotech sector and any upcoming scientific presentations.
